Marks & Spencer

Marks & Spencer (M&S) is an international retailer with its headquarters in the United Kingdom. The company sells clothing food, home, and other products in the UK and internationally. The company's operations are divided into two segments: UK retail and Lilysilk Silk Fitted Sheet international business. The company was founded by Michael Marks and Vimeo Thomas Spencer on September 28, 1884. The company's shares are traded at the London Stock Exchange.

Marks and Spencer is known for its long-standing commitment to quality, particularly in the area of customer service. In fact it was one of the first retailers to allow customers to return items that did not meet expectations. The emphasis on quality has earned it an undisputed reputation for being a good place to buy clothing and food items.

The early days of M&S were marked by low prices practicality, and the sale of foodstuffs and household goods. It also offered a relaxed shopping environment, with open displays and the option to select items by yourself. As incomes increased as well, the M&S range of products grew to include more refined clothing and household products.

Boots

Boots is the largest pharmacy chain, having outlets on all high streets. It has expanded from its roots as a traditional chemist adding photo-processing in one hour and opticians to a number of its stores. It also sells food products and beauty items. Boots is an international leader and also produces pharmaceuticals such as the painkiller Ibuprofen.
